To summarize, there are two requests for Adoptium to consider:
- Blocker: Provide an RPM package that Provides specific versions of Java
- Regression: Provide a headless RPM package.
What does this actually mean?
For 1. Provide an RPM package that Provides specific versions of Java
RPMs have a dependency mechanism using strings via Provides, BuildRequires, and Requires fields in the RPM spec file. For example: https://github.com/adoptium/installer/blob/master/linux/jdk/redhat/src/main/packaging/temurin/21/temurin-21-jdk.spec#L77
For some historical reason, Temurin RPMs do not specify a version in the provide field.
Provides: java
If we did, it would so look like:
Provides: java = 1:21.0.2.0.0.13-2.fc40
In comparison, other vendors like Amazon, Azul, and Red Hat, have explicit versions for their RPM's Provides fields.
Why does this matter?
The lack of a version is problematic. If Temurin 21 is installed on the system, and the Fedora user installs a package that needs JDK 8, then it would be satisfied by Temurin 21, but not actually work.
For 2. Provide a headless RPM package.
This is a subpackage in the same spec file that has a related files and dependencies removed to run in a headless environment with a smaller footprint.

If the jdk is system jdk (is_system_jdk 1) then a version-less provides like java
java-devel
... are provided. If not ((is_system_jdk 0) then only version-full like java-XY
java-xy-devel
provides are provided.
The whole point is to distinguish system jdk against any other jdk. Only system jdk have versionless provides.
This allows us to move system jdk without touches to java aplications. This system have evolved in years, and is perfectly working.

The metapackage is package with only with provides. Such package require the real package, which itself do not have the provides.
So in this exact scope it may be (but I hope it will be done better):
- current rpms will be renamed to be more fedora-friendly, and will drop versinless provides
- a metapackages, created as additional set of subpkgs in your spec, wil be generated. Each requiring one of above, and providing the versionless provides
- in your current repos both those sests will reside so the users will get transparent set of packages with allprovides
- second repo will be created, which will not contain the metapackages, so only version-full prvides will be provided by those packages.

The user is anybody who do not want to mess its system by X and other windowing depndecs, no metter what reason it is. Cool example is any build system. But unluckily java-devel rewuires full jre, not jsut jre-headless.
java-headless is actually a default requires anybody should use, unless they really requires X for rutime. So the answer for you is every deployment and every cli user who do not need devel which is quite a lot.

here is the jira: https://issues.redhat.com/browse/OPENJDK-2507
The "provides" value has changed in java-1.8.0-openjdk-headless.x86_64,
version 1:1.8.0.392.b08-2.el7_9, rpm.
Previous versions of this package listed "java-headless = 1:1.8.0", and
u392 has a specific minor version tied to it: "java-headless =
1:1.8.0.392.b08-2.el7_9".
The result is that third-party packages that require specifically
"java-headless 1:1.8.0" are not compatible with the new version 392.
As this revert goes only to old rhels, not to the future, temurins should use full version string also for versionless provides.

I think the removal of versionless provides is mandatory in all three cases (moreover as you summ up in last paragraph).
Moreover expected case:
- some special usecase requires legacy, eg jdk8, on jdk-free fedora isntallation
- as recomanded in guidelines, user installs temurin8
- all good
- system stops to be jdk-free, once user install some repositories based java application
- system jdk will not be installed as temurin8 provides versionless provides.
- new application will die with some reasonable exceptrion or with invalid bytecode level
Unexpected case:
- lets have regular fedora installation
- during its lifetime, user installs any temurin jdk
- during system update to next Fedora, where system jdk changed, theirs system jdk will not be updated, becasue temurin provides versionless provides.
- where original system jdk lost them, and remained updated on disk
- the new one, which started to get them, will not be pulled to transaction, because temruin is satisfying system jdk update provides

This is quite long but I'm adding in this comment as a summary for my own benefit and for anyone else reading it as an explanation of the concern with what Temurin currently does that blocks Fedora using our rpm files. This is specific to the versioning and does NOT cover any discussion relating to headless.
Fedora is considering removing their older openjdk packages and encouraging users to move to Temurin instead. They have a number of options for this, however a blocker to any user migration story is that they need RPM packages that Provides specific versions of Java and do not Provide: java
which the current temurin ones do (See Temurin redhatspec file)
Fedora expects that any package which satisfies the requirement for java
will be the one that was typically the latest java LTS specification (Currently java 21) at the time of the release of that distribution and therefore it would be inappropriate for any earlier (or later) implementation to be advertising itself as providing java
to the system. They would like Temurin to only provide java-21
and similar and not a default java
implementation from the package manager's perspective.
To see the concern in action, running rpm -q provides java
on a recent Fedora system (e.g. 40 - if you're using something pre-dnf then yum whatprovides java
will give the same information) will show this - note that the java-17-openjdk
and other earlier versions are not shown in this list:
java-21-openjdk-1:21.0.2.0.13-3.fc40.aarch64 : OpenJDK 21 Runtime Environment
Repo : fedora
Matched from:
Provide : java = 1:21.0.2.0.13-3.fc40
If you add in the Temurin repositories there will be entries for all of the different versions available from Temurin, which is in conflict with the Fedora requirements.

Some notes:
- The earlier Fedora java-NN-openjdk packages do still install themselves as
java
in /etc/alternatives/java etc. but will be overridden if you subsequently install the "system" JDK of 21. By contrast if you have, for example, Fedora's JDK17 installed and then install temurin-8-jdk the the defaultjava
will become Temurin 8 and attempts to rundnf install java
will not result in JDK21 being installed (because temurin-8-jdkProvides: java
), which is likely to break dependencies for products expectingjava
to be 21 on that distribution. Fundamentally it's a problem with consistency. - While I've given examples for Fedora 40, for other distributions the "expected" package that
Provides: java
may be different so just saying "The latest LTS can haveProvides: java
" is not appropriate as a solution here. For example on UBI9 it is java 11, and while they have later versions in the repository they do not haveProvides: java
and java 11 overrides 17 as the default on that distribution. Currently Temurin will always override the default regardless of which version is installed because itProvides: java
- The "system" JDK version in Fedora is done with the
is_system_jdk
variable in their spec files e.g. java-17 and java-21 - There is a section in the spec files that choose whether to provide
java
based on this value:
Provides: java-%{origin}%{?1} = %{epoch}:%{version}-%{release}
Provides: jre-%{origin}%{?1} = %{epoch}:%{version}-%{release}
Provides: java%{?1} = %{epoch}:%{version}-%{release}
Provides: jre%{?1} = %{epoch}:%{version}-%{release}
%endif
The concern from a Temurin perspective is that this cannot be replicated with a single RPM (Since the distribution determines which one is the "system" JDK and Temurin currently does not provide multiple RPMs for each distribution and I think we we would prefer not to start doing so, especially since we'd rather reduce the complexity of our uploads as per #501
